Node 22 ships npm 10.x which doesn't support trusted publishing via
OIDC (requires npm 11.5.1+). Node 24 bundles it natively, removing the
need for the `npm install -g npm@latest` step which was failing with a
`Cannot find module 'promise-retry'` error due to npm corrupting itself
during self-upgrade.
GITHUB_TOKEN can't trigger CI on PRs it creates, so the changesets
release PR could never pass required checks. Use a GitHub App token
instead, which triggers workflows normally.
